I have on premise AWS S3 like storage. I need to list all files on specific bucket. When I am doing it at the top of the bucket I am getting error:
Error during pagination: The same next token was received twice:{'ContinuationToken':"file path"}
It happens when two many objects needs to be listed I think. This is something wrong at storage side but there is no cure for that right now.
I did a workaround for that and run S3 ls in the bash loop while. I manage to prepare a simple loop for different bucket where I have a much fewer number of objects. That loop were operating deep inside where I knew how many dirs I have.
./aws --profile us-bucket --endpoint-url https://endpoint:18082 --no-verify-ssl s3 ls us-bucket/dir1/dir2/dir3/dir4/dir5/dir6/ | tr -s ' '| tr '/' ' ' | awk '{print $2}' | while read line0; do ./aws --profile us-bucket --endpoint-url https://endpoint:18082 --no-verify-ssl s3 ls us-bucket/dir1/dir2/dir3/dir4/dir5/dir6/${line0}/| tr -s ' '| tr '/' ' ' | awk '{print $2}' | while read line1; do ./aws --profile us-bucket --endpoint-url https://endpoint:18082 --no-verify-ssl s3 ls us-bucket/dir1/dir2/dir3/dir4/dir5/dir6/${line0}/${line1}/| tr -s ' '| tr '/' ' ' | awk '{print $2}' |while read line2; do ./aws --profile us-bucket --endpoint-url https://endpoint:18082 --no-verify-ssl s3 ls --recursive us-bucket/dir1/dir2/dir3/dir4/dir5/dir6/${line0}/${line1}/${line2}/;done;done;done > /tmp/us-bucket/us-bucket_dir2_dir3_dir4_dir5_dir6.txt
I would like to write loop which go from the top or root (how you prefer) and list all files (no matter how many dir we have on the path) from the last dir in the path going up to avoid appearing:
